What it is, How it works

Hair analysis has become recognized as an effective approach for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. The hair shaft retains a prolonged record of substances, capturing biomarkers within its fibers as it grows. When obtained close to the scalp, hair can offer a detection period for alcohol and drugs lasting up to about three months. Hair is easy to gather, relatively hard to tamper with, and straightforward to send.

A 1.5-inch section encompassing roughly 200 hair strands (approximately the width of a #2 pencil) nearest to the scalp yields 100mg of hair, the optimal quantity for both screening and verification. For EtG, add-ons, or tests exceeding 10 panels, 150mg of the sample is advisable. We suggest using a jeweler’s scale for weighing the sample. If scalp hair isn't available, a comparable volume of body hair can be used. "Head hair" exclusively means scalp hair, whereas "body hair" implies all other hair types (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The lab procedure for processing a drug test result involves four stages: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ning includes initially processing a sample into the lab’s system, which ensures the sample was sealed and sent correctly, assigns a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and finishes any further data entry not covered by an electronic chain of custody system.

Screening provides an initial simple check for the presence of drugs. Though Screening is a cost-effective method to exclude drug use in most samples, any positive result requires confirmation for court acceptability. Samples that test positive during Screening need a secondary verification.

If a sample is positive during the Screening phase, additional hair is drawn from the original sample for Extraction. Here, drugs are removed from hair at much lower concentrations than other methods (e.g., urine or oral fluid), making hair drug testing the most challenging methodology to execute.

Any confirmed positive screening outcome is verified via G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Presumptive positive samples undergo washing prior to confirmation if required. The overall lab workflow from Accessioning to Confirmation is examined under both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and compliance with ISO/IEC 17025 stand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ug testing can identify drug intake for up to 90 days, unlike urine tests with a shorter detection duration.
  • Challenging to tamper with: Cheating a hair drug test is highly difficult, thus ensuring more precise outcomes.
  • Offers historical insight: It can reveal a trend of substance use over time, rather than just recent intake.

Limitations:

  • Cannot identify recent intake: Drugs take around 5-7 days to be detectable in hair.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ests usually come at a higher cost than other drug testing techniques.
  • Result variations: Variables such as hair color and individual hair growth differences can influence drug metabolite levels in the hair.

Note: While commonly called "hair follicle tests", the assessment examines the hair strand rather than the follicle beneath the scalp

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.
